re: motion filter

From Technical Description page of JVC's mini-site:
http://pro.jvc.com/prof/Attributes/t...&feature_id=02

"Smooth Motion Function (patented)
JVC's exclusive smooth motion function captures images at double the normal rate when shooting in 30p or 25p (that is, at 60p or 50p). When the doubled images are merged, they are passed through a newly developed filter that smoothes out the subject's motion by retaining a small percentage of residual image. This eliminates the motion judder that typically appear in images shot at 30p or 25p."
